macOS SierraにServerを移行(その5)

phpまわりでハマりました。
もともとServer.appにはphpが入っています。
で、一生懸命/opt/local/etc/php56/php.iniを弄っていました。だけどphpが読んでいるのは/etc/php.ini。
反映されないはずだ。(^_^;;

phpinfo()を確認していて、ようやくのこと気付きました。
最終的にMacPorts版に置き換えるとして、動くこと優先。
最初にMySQLとの接続です。
で、またここで躓きました。(^_^;;

podと標準のmysql-socketは定義したのに、mysqliのsocket pathを入れていなかった。
なので、全然繋がらない。

さて、前回悩んでいたMySQLのroot接続の問題。(コマンドラインからも接続できなかった)
どうやったんだか判りません。が、password無しで接続できるようになりました。
password設定より前に、現行版のServerからダンプしてきたデーターを放り込みます。
ユーザー設定もへったくれもなく、入れるだけ入れてしまいました。

phpMyAdmin経由で個別の設定をしていきます。(phpMyAdminのconfig fileを弄ってno passwordに対応させました)
そこで漸くroot passwordの設定、各ユーザーの登録とデータベースの権限設定。

テスト環境として以前作っていたデータベースに接続しようとしました。
今度はPEARが無いと弾かれた。(どうやって入れたのかもうすっかり忘れています)

WordPressの方も保存フォルダの位置が変わってしまったため、リダイレクトで無限ループしてしまいます。
……終わった?

一応、移行するための流れだけは決まりました。
webのデータは、rsyuncで同期。
データベースは、mysqldumpで取り出したデータを放り込んでお終い。
後はその時次第。(^_^;;

コメントを残す